Welcome today we're going to take a deep dive into Adobe's ScriptUI so you will be able to make your own dockable panels in most of the Adobe programs. (After Effects, Illustrator, Premier, Photoshop, etc) This is a follow up of my 'After Effects Scripting for Absolute Beginners' tutorial.
For this particular tutorial I'll will be working with After Effects but the ScriptUI programming applies almost the whole Adobe suite. I'll be using Visual Studio Code to create the script because not everybody can use the Extendscript Toolkit nowadays because of compatibility issues. What is ScriptUI? Well UI stands for User Interface so it's a module within the Adobe library that you can use to create your own panels for your scripts. So you can use this to create dockable panels for After Effects, Illustrator, Photoshop, Premier, etc.
